- The distance between Maastricht, Netherlands and Asheville, North Carolina, Usa is approximately 6,926 km or 4,304 mi.
- To reach Maastricht in this distance one would set out from Asheville, North Carolina bearing 45.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Maastricht bearing 113.1° or ESE .
- Maastricht has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Asheville, North Carolina has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 3.4 °C (6.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.4 °C (9.7°F) less in Maastricht.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 449.2 mm (17.7 in) less which is equivalent to 449.2 l/m² (11.02 US gal/ft²) or 4,492,000 l/ha (480,225 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.5° lower in Maastricht than in Asheville, North Carolina.
- Relative humidity levels are 26.9%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.3°C (4.2°F) higher.
